Abstract

Perkembangan teknologi dalam memanfaatkan telemedicine memiliki banyak manfaat dan keuntungan, namun praktik telemedicine juga memiliki kerentanan akan keamanan dan kepastian hukum terkait kepastian hukum sebagai rujukan perlindungan baik dari sisi pasien maupun tenaga kesehatan. Tulisan ini berusaha untuk menganalisis tentang praktik telemedicine di Indonesia dengan variabel perlindungan hak pasien, tenaga kesehatan, dan keamanan data dalam formulasi kebijakan nasional pasca disahkannya Undang-Undang Nomor 17 Tahun 2023 tentang Kesehatan. Metode penelitian yang digunakan adalah penelitian hukum Pustaka dengan pendekatan perundang-undangan, pendekatan analisis dan pendekatan konseptual. Hasil penelitian menunjukkan bahwa Pasca disahkannya Undang-Undang Nomor 17 Tahun 2023 tentang Kesehatan menunjukan adanya arah progresif terhadap pengaturan telemedicine yang akan diatur ke dalam peraturan turunan dari Undang-Undang tersebut. Dari tinjauan hukum responsif, negara memiliki tanggung jawab untuk hadir untuk memberikan perlindungan hukum terhadap penggunaan telemedicine baik bagi pasien maupun tenaga kesehatan, hal ini semata-semata dimaksudkan untuk tercapainya prinsip tujuan hukum yang berkepastian, keadilan, dan kemanfaatan.

Abstract

The implementation of criminal provisions for Road operators which resulted in accidents in South Halmahera District is not effective because until now there has been no complaints / reports and demands from the community to the South Halmahera Resort Police related to traffic accidents due to damaged roads. This is because the public does not understand the existing rules (criminal provisions in Article 273 of Law Number 22 Year 2009) due to lack of socialization and legal counseling to the public. Community ignorance of existing rules (criminal provisions in Article 273 of Law Number 22 Year 2009) and the non-proactive role of the police in following up on traffic accidents experienced by the community due to damaged roads and lack of socialization and legal counseling by the government to Public.

Abstract

Article 18 of Law Number 48 of 2009 concerning Judicial Power determines that judicial power is exercised by a Supreme Court and judicial bodies under it in the general court, religious courts, military courts, state administrative courts, and by an Constitutional Court. Each judicial environment has competence, both absolute and relative competence. The absolute competence of the judiciary is the jurisdiction of the judiciary in examining certain types of cases which are absolutely unable to be examined by other court bodies, either in the same judicial environment or in a different judicial environment. In connection with disputes involving sharia banking, until now it is still a matter of debate, which court has the authority to try them. Not to mention that until now there are still decisions of district courts that accept and grant claims which are disputes involving sharia banking. This means that internally the Supreme Court alone, in this case the judges in making decisions are still unable to provide legal certainty regarding absolute competence in adjudicating disputes involving sharia banking

Abstract

Legal protection of domestic workers in Indonesia currently does not have a legal regulation. The Manpower Law also does not accommodate legal protection for domestic workers who are not considered as a worker. The only one regulation related to domestic workers in Indonesia is a ministerial regulation with a legal force that does not accommodate all the fulfillment of rights and obligations that are unclear to domestic workers especially who are recruited directly. The government has not yet established a special agency/ institution to provide legal protection for domestic workers that make Non-Government Organization (NGO) involved more in handling this matter. The absence of a legal regulation for the protection of domestic workers is a major cause of rights violations for domestic workers itself. In dealing with these conditions, the authors propose the need for the establishment of special law of domestic workers who are recruited directly and manifested through the establishment of the Domestic Workers Handling Institution as a solutive step in realizing civilized justice for domestic workers as a worker. The formation can be done in several ways, first, providing legal certainty and guarantee through the establishment of a specially hired domestic labor law, which includes the rights, and obligations of workers and employers. Secondly, to establish an institute for Domestic Workers Handlings that have the competence such as data of domestic worker, training and protection for domestic worker as a worker. In this writing, the author uses primary, secondary, and non-legal material. Legal material is obtained through literature research method then the material obtained is analyzed qualitatively and presented descriptively. The expected outcome is the realization of legal protection for domestic workers as a worker who is recruited directly as mandated by the constitution.

Abstract

Aceh, as one of the autonomous regions in the context of the Unitary State of the Republic of Indonesia, in the practice of implementing Local Government, repeatedly not only positions the type and hierarchy of laws and regulations following Law No. 12 of 2011 on the Establishment of Laws and Regulations but also positions the Helsinki MoU as one of the legal sources. The thing that is the practice in this writing is related to how the implementation of the Helsinki MoU in criminal law policy in Aceh. Research methods are conducted with normative legal research methods and prescriptive research. Data collection in this study is done through literature research. Data analysis is done with qualitative analysis; the process of data analysis and using legal data is also possible to use non-legal data. This study showed that after the MoU of peace between the Indonesian government and GAM was marked on August 15, 2005, in Helsinki, Finland, 24 governments then passed Law No. 11 of 2006 on the aceh government. This law is a political commitment of the Indonesian government in following up on the results of the peace agreement in Helsinki. One of the authorities (autonomy/self-government) granted in the law is to implement Islamic sharia in Aceh in a kaffah both in terms of worship, education, muamalat, shiar, civil law, and criminal law. While implementing the Helsinki MoU is, the regulation related to Jinayat (Criminal Law) has strengthened. Other judicial institutions are also concerned about implementing criminal law in Aceh, although the rules about Criminal Law still cause debate.
